Alberobello, a fairytale-like town in the Puglia region, is famous for its unique trulli houses.
These small, white-washed, cone-shaped dwellings make the town look like something out of a storybook. Explore the UNESCO-listed trulli district, visit the Trullo Sovrano, a two-story trullo house turned museum, and immerse yourself in the enchanting atmosphere of this charming town. Alberobello provides a glimpse into the ancient traditions and architecture of southern Italy, making it a hidden gem that should not be missed.
